mirror of https://github.com/OpenIdentityPlatform/OpenDJ.git

Nicolas Capponi
22.02.2014 eb1530c0c9eeb3a860e1d601f861eb5e2989538b
refs
author Nicolas Capponi <nicolas.capponi@forgerock.com>
Monday, September 22, 2014 12:02 +0200
committer Nicolas Capponi <nicolas.capponi@forgerock.com>
Monday, September 22, 2014 12:02 +0200
commiteb1530c0c9eeb3a860e1d601f861eb5e2989538b
tree f0d60b78a67520f764ec42212c910f391b1606dc tree | zip | gz
parent df8af541e0b60da31ebd5963d50bb2646fea9846 view | diff
OPENDJ-1483: On Windows, problem with changelog's file rotation when running 
replication topology with file-based changelog
OPENDJ-1487: File based changelog : cursors opened when clearing the log

[Note: real merge of all changelog.file package content to be done in one shot in
a future commit]

Log.java :
* Ensure cursors opened on log are temporarily disabled before rotating
the head (to avoid renaming the file while reader are opened on it)
* Allow cursors to be opened on log when performing a clear on the log,
turning them into empty cursors.
1 files modified
6 ■■■■■ changed files
opendj3-server-dev/src/server/org/opends/server/replication/server/changelog/je/ReplicationDbEnv.java 6 ●●●●● diff | view | raw | blame | history